Biography

Ansell Fernandez is a member of the Private Wealth Services Practice in Greenberg Traurig’s Miami office, where he advises clients on a broad range of international and domestic tax, trust, and estate planning matters. He focuses his practice on representing high-net-worth individuals, multinational families, closely held businesses, and fiduciaries in complex cross-border tax planning, compliance, and wealth transfer strategies.

Ansell counsels clients on U.S. federal income, gift, and estate tax matters, including those involving real estate investments, business ventures, and expatriation planning. He regularly advises U.S. individuals and businesses on outbound tax planning issues. He also represents foreign clients investing in the United States on a wide range of inbound tax matters, including pre-immigration tax planning, corporate restructurings, portfolio debt planning, and U.S. real property investments.

In addition to his transactional work, Ansell represents clients in federal tax controversy matters, including IRS penalty appeals, streamlined filing compliance procedures, and Delinquent FBAR Submission Procedures. He also provides ongoing counsel to individual and corporate fiduciaries on trust and estate administration, including post-mortem tax planning and probate-related issues.
